TWO TYPES OF FLIGHTS!
POINT TO POINT
All pilots participating will fly between a designated departure and arrival airport. Pilots should be ready to start pushback at 0120z.
DEPART 0120z
TIME ON TARGET
All pilots will be provided a designated destination for the flight as well as a time on target by which pilots should land. Choice of departure airports are at the discretion of the pilots.

F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S
Do I have to fly on VATSIM?
Yes, all flights must be conducted in real-time on the VATSIM network.
What is the BRAVO 737 Call Sign on VATSIM?
The official BRAVO 737 Call Sign is the word "BISON" and the number of your flight. For instance, your call sign would be "BISON 45" or "BISON 298" When filing your flight plan on the VATSIM network, you can utilize BZN plus your flight number. In the NOTES at the bottom of the plan, type: Callsign=BISON and your number.

What type of aircraft can/should I fly?
Generally, we fly airliners such as the Boeing series or Airbus series. You can fly other aircraft, however, we have found it is difficult to maintain the constraints of time when flying either much faster or slower aircraft.

Why can't I see accurate livery/model matching?
In order to see accurate livery/model matching, you must have the correct CSL files (X-Plane/xPilot) or VMR and aircraft files (MSFS2020/vPilot). We have tried to offer as many as we can, but if we have omitted an aircraft livery, or you'd like to add your own, please contact us here.
